EASLEY GOVERNOR December 27, 2006 Mr. David Baker, NCDOT Regulatory Project Manager U.S. Army Corps of Engineers 151 Patton Avenue, Room 208 Asheville, NC 28801-2714 LYNDO TIPPETT SECRETARY Ogj967 Subject: Nationwide 14 and NW 33 Permit Application SR 1510 -Ray Best Road Haywood County State Project No. 140.044072 (DWQ Minor Permit Fee S200) Dear Mr. Baker: The North Carolina Department of Transportation (NCDOT) is proposing to widen, grade, and pave SR 1510, Ray Best Road, in Haywood County from SR 1509 for a distance of 1,600 feet to the end of the project. This proposal entails widening and paving the existing gravel road to a standard 18-foot roadway. The proposed improvements of SR 1 ~ 10 have been identified as necessary maintenance and safety improvements. Funds have been allocated for this project, and NCDOT would like to perform these activities sometime during the 2007-08 paving season. I am sending astraight-line diagram with the proposed erosion control and construction limits along this project. In addition, I am sending a typical section of the road, cross sections, drawings for pipe culvert replacements as well as a marked county map and USGS quad map. We propose to install the new culverts slightly below the existing streambed elevations where bedrock is not encountered to minimize impacts to aquatic habitats and allow the existing stream gradients to remain as unchanged as physically possible. The North Carolina Natural Heritage Database was checked for records of threatened and endangered species. There are no records of threatened and endangered species for the unnamed tributary to Rogers Cove Creek. Additionally, there are no records listed for the entire Crabtree Creek watershed. These proposed culvert replacements and extensions are on small (1-foot wide) tributaries that are not of sufficient size to support mussels and are not likely to provide fish habitat. The impacts from two culvert replacements will be very minimal. For these reasons, we believe there will be "no effect" on threatened or endangered species. Impacts to historic or cultural resources are not anticipated. If the State Historic Preservation Office (SHPO) and the Office of State Archaeology determines that further investigations are required, NCDOT will conduct the appropriate site investigations and obtain compliance from SHPO prior to project construction. The best management practices will be used to minimize and control sedimentation and erosion on this project. The construction foreman will review all erosion control measures daily to ensure sedimentation and erosion is being effectively controlled. If the planned devices are not functioning as intended, they will be immediately replaced with better devices. The rock silt screens and other erosion control devices will be in place prior to pipe culvert construction and will remain in place until the project is stabilized. Impacts to Waters of the United States The unnamed tributaries to Rogers Cove Creek are small and are not shown on USGS topographic maps. These spring seeps appear to have perennial flow. The channels are defined and lack vegetation. The substrate is silt and sand. For these reasons, we believe these streams are under the jurisdiction of the U.S. Army Corps of Engineers. In order to construct the project in accordance with our current secondary road standards, it will be necessary to impact waters of the United States in the French Broad River Basin. Specifically, NCDOT is requesting to extend/replace two metal culverts in unnamed tributaries to Rogers Cove Creek (DWQ Class C) and to place temporary impervious dikes in the stream above the pipes to de-water the channel through the work area.
